About This Course

Unlock the complexities of Self-Managed Superannuation Fund (SMSF) loans and Limited Recourse Borrowing Arrangements (LRBAs) with this essential course, "SMSF Loans & LRBAs: What You Can (and Can't) Do." Gain crucial insights into the legal framework, practical applications, and potential pitfalls to ensure robust compliance and strategic financial planning for your clients.

This course dives deep into critical areas, providing a comprehensive understanding of when and how SMSFs can engage in lending and borrowing activities. You'll learn to navigate the intricate rules of the SIS Act and ATO regulations, transform dry legislation into actionable checklists, and avoid common compliance breaches.

Key learning outcomes include:

  • Understanding the key rules in the SIS Act regarding related party lending and borrowing.
  • Mastering the essential structural elements of LRBAs, including the role of the Bare Trust.
  • Identifying and mitigating common compliance issues and structural pitfalls in LRBAs.
  • Navigating the complexities of related entities in joint ventures, partnerships, and property deals.
  • Defining and assessing control, influence, and in-house asset thresholds according to ATO guidelines.
  • Learning from ATO scrutiny and recent compliance actions to proactively address potential issues.
  • Discovering common errors in SMSF loan and LRBA arrangements and implementing effective rectification strategies.

From formal loan agreements and trustee resolutions to understanding the sole purpose test and in-house asset rules, this course equips you with the knowledge to provide sound advice and ensure your clients' SMSFs operate within stringent regulatory boundaries. Whether it's managing temporary funding, dealing with post-acquisition improvements, or setting up compliant unit trusts, you'll gain the confidence to handle even the most intricate scenarios. Avoid the 'Gnarly Trap' of non-arm's length income and improper Bare Trusts, and learn how to proactively engage with clients to safeguard their investments. By the end of this course, you'll be adept at identifying risks, implementing best practices, and ensuring continuous compliance, positioning yourself as a trusted advisor in the SMSF landscape.
